PK05 OAX is a 2005 Rover 45 in Silver with a 1,396c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 63.6%.
Across all 2005 Rover 45 models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.0% with a typical mileage of 48,176 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Rover 45 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 48,934 recorded failures. If you're considering buying PK05 OAX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Rover 45 typ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 21 years old, this Rover 45 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
